Infrastructure Challenges in Bold Conversational AI Scaling
Cloud vs. On-Premise for Bold Conversational AI
Choosing the right infrastructure is your first big decision. Cloud services like AWS or Google Cloud AI offer flexibility, but can be costly if not optimized.
Problems you may face:
-
Latency during peak usage
-
Data privacy issues
-
Server overload and crashes
To scale efficiently, use hybrid setups or deploy regional nodes close to users.
Training and Data Volume in Bold Conversational AI
Why More Users Break Bold AI Models
The more people interact with your AI, the more complex your dataset becomes. Poor training data causes bots to give wrong or repetitive answers.
Challenges include:
-
Managing multi-language conversations
-
Adapting to slang and user typos
-
Keeping training data updated
Solutions? Use transfer learning to adapt large language models and automate model retraining based on feedback loops.
Integration with Enterprise Systems
Connecting Bold Conversational AI to Existing Tools
Scaling is difficult when your bold AI can’t talk to your CRM, ticketing systems, or knowledge bases.
Common pain points:
-
Inconsistent APIs
-
Data syncing delays
-
Security vulnerabilities
Using tools like Zapier or Mulesoft can speed up integration. Always test new features in a staging environment.
Operational Risks with Bold Conversational AI
Handling Downtime and Failures at Scale
When things break, thousands of users are affected. Unplanned outages can lead to lost revenue and poor customer trust.
To avoid this:
-
Set up auto-scaling policies
-
Use backup chat systems or fallbacks
-
Monitor performance 24/7 with tools like Datadog
Add service-level agreements (SLAs) to ensure all teams know their responsibilities in case of failure.

Security and Compliance Concerns
Protecting Data in Bold Conversational AI Systems
Handling user data at scale means higher risks. Compliance with laws like GDPR, HIPAA, or CCPA is a must.
Steps to follow:
-
Encrypt all messages
-
Perform regular security audits
-
Limit access to sensitive datasets
Use compliance tools from platforms like Microsoft Azure AI to stay safe.
FAQs
1. What is the biggest challenge when scaling bold conversational AI?
Managing infrastructure and ensuring consistent performance across regions.
2. How can I improve accuracy in scaled AI bots?
Retrain with updated data regularly and fine-tune language models based on real-world feedback.
3. Should I go cloud or on-premise for scaling?
Cloud is easier to start with. On-premise may be better for compliance-heavy industries.
4. Can bold conversational AI fully replace human support?
No. The best systems blend AI automation with human escalation when needed.
